Step 1: Choose the Right Fruits and Vegetables

Not all fruits and vegetables are suitable for guinea pigs. Some of them contain harmful chemicals or are too high in sugar, which can lead to digestive problems. When selecting fruits and vegetables for your guinea pig, stick to the following safe options:

Dark leafy greens: kale, spinach, romaine lettuce, and Swiss chard

  • Carrots and carrots tops
  • Bell peppers
  • Apples (without the seeds and core)
  • Pears
  • Peas
  • Cucumber
  • Squash

Step 2: Wash Thoroughly

It is important to wash your fruits and vegetables thoroughly to remove any harmful pesticides or bacteria. Simply rinse them under running water for a few minutes and pat dry with a clean cloth.

Step 3: Cut into Bite-Sized Pieces

Cut your fruits and vegetables into bite-sized pieces that are easy for your guinea pig to eat. This will also help them to digest their food properly.

Step 4: Introduce Slowly

When introducing new foods to your guinea pig's diet, it is important to do it slowly. Start with a small amount of the new food and gradually increase it over the next few days. This will give your guinea pig's digestive system time to adjust to the new food.

Step 5: Offer in Moderation

Fresh fruits and vegetables should be offered in moderation and should not make up more than 20% of your guinea pig's diet. Too much of these foods can lead to digestive problems and obesity.

The Benefits of Fresh Fruits and Vegetables

Fresh fruits and vegetables are an excellent source of vitamins, minerals, and fiber that are essential for your guinea pig's health and well-being. They also provide a natural source of hydration, which is important for their overall health.

In addition, fresh fruits and vegetables offer a variety of health benefits, including:

  • Improved digestion
  • Increased energy levels
  • Stronger immune system
  • Better eye health
  • Healthy skin and fur
